Forma Design Fair Madrid: How To Spot Stunning Craft by Bonis Pantelis 23/03/2026

Madrid finally has its design fair — and it arrived with something to say. 🇪🇸

Forma Design Fair Madrid made its debut in March 2026 at Matadero Madrid. From Arturo Álvarez's shadow-as-material lighting to La Ebanistería's cabinet reveal that stopped a crowd in its tracks, this fair proved one thing clearly: Spain has been doing collectable design for generations. It just never called it that.

Founder Álvaro Matías promised "the most beautiful design shop in Spain." He delivered. And with the Madrid Design Festival as its backdrop, Forma arrived with a cultural infrastructure most debut fairs can only dream of.

Objects speak across centuries — but only when someone places them well. This fair placed them brilliantly.

Cliff Hotel Greece: How To Vanish Into the Cliffs by Bonis Pantelis 22/03/2026

🪨 A cliff hotel in Greece that hides inside the rock — not on it.

Olen resort on the island of Syros does something almost no Greek hotel dares to do: it disappears into the landscape. Designed by ATENO, this seven-suite project carves into the cliffside rather than standing on it. The result is architecture that feels like it was always there.

As a product designer and design critic, I find the logic here razor-sharp. Three zones — The Plane, The Line, The Point — descend the cliff in sequence. Each one gives more privacy. Each one returns more of the view to the sea.

And the material choices follow that same discipline: warm renders above, raw exposed stone at the base. The architecture, in other words, confesses what it is made of.

Sotiris Lazou: How to Design a Timeless Lamp by Bonis Pantelis 21/03/2026

What happens when a designer refuses to add anything that doesn't belong?

You get LucerA.

Athens designer Sotiris Lazou teamed up with Urbi et Orbi — the Greek concrete design studio — to create a rechargeable table lamp made of terrazzo and resin. Handmade. Cast in three parts. Polished by hand. And powered by a battery that gives you eight hours of warm, cord-free light.

In 2022, The Chicago Athenaeum International Museum awarded it a Good Design Award — one of the oldest design prizes on earth.

The reason it works is simple: every material earns its place. Concrete gives permanence. Resin lets the light through. The battery sets it free.

That is the Enzo Mari school of thought. And Lazou carries it forward better than most.

Studio GGSV: How To Master the Art of Paris Salons by Bonis Pantelis 20/03/2026

Three rooms. Two centuries of craft. One question that changed everything.

What if a room wasn't just furnished — but felt like it was thinking?

That's what Studio GGSV set out to answer when Manufactures Nationales gave them the most ambitious brief of the Art Deco centenary: reimagine the ensemblier for 2025.
The result is Les Salons de l'imaginaire — a 200m² installation at the historic Manufacture des Gobelins in Paris. Three rooms. Each one a different argument about how furniture, architecture, and décor can become a single voice.

↳ The Reception Salon, where a monumental library shifts between pattern and structure depending on where you stand.
↳ The Conversation Salon, where French salon culture meets Middle Eastern majlis hospitality around one extraordinary sofa.
↳ The Reading Salon, where romantic landscapes swallow the architecture whole — walls, floor, ceiling, all of it.

Furthermore, every piece of furniture was built from scratch. Moreover, every piece assembles without a single screw. That's not a styling decision. That's a philosophy.
